How to answer difficult questions and keep the conversation going?
설명
I am Ann I talk about how to resolve problems at work caused due to lack of communication skills.
In this podcast, I want to talk about what to do when you don’t know the answer to a question or when you are clueless about the topic of discussion.
Usually, when people don’t know what to say they try to change the subject or dodge the question. In a more professional setting when you don’t have the answers, you say you will get back to them later. If you can get away with this, it’s great. In another video, I will share how to do so in worst-case scenarios.
In another scenario where you don’t know what people are talking about, you end up listening and smiling pretending to be a part of the conversation. You want to be included and want to be part of the discussion but don’t know how to since that topic is unknown territory for you. So in this video, I want to share how to deal with difficult questions or speak on topics you don’t know a thing about. At the same time, this method will help you build rapport with people, keep the conversation going and come across as someone smart.
We will achieve this in three steps. First, when someone asks you a question you ask them to be more specific. In step 2 you make a personal comment and follow up with another question to dig for more information on that subject. And finally, you ask for the speaker’s opinion on the matter.
